Guild Wars Introduced

Guild Wars, also recognized as GW, is an episodic Massively Multiplayer Online Game (MMOG) that was created by ArenaNet and published by NCsoft. The first GW campaign (episode) called Guild Wars Prophecies was released in April 2005. The second campaign, titled Guild WarsFactions, was released one year later in April 2006. The third campaign, Guild Wars Nightfall, was released in October 2006. A fourth campaign, Guild Wars: Eye of the North was scheduled for release in 2007 but was later announced that it will be the games first expansion pack instead of a fourth campaign. Unlike most MMORPGs, Guild Wars has no monthly subscription fees and is more inviting to casual players. To avoid repetitive gameplay GW offers features such as player controlled NPC henchmen which are similar to gaming bots, low maximum Guild Wars levels, and instanced game regions. The Guild Wars journey begins in the world of Tyria. Players may choose to participate in PvP (player versus player) or PvE (player versus environment) game play. In PvE gameplay, gamers explore the lands in search of Guild Wars quests and missions to complete and monsters to conquer for rewards such as gold, items, skills and skill points, and experience points. In PvP combat, teams battle it out in area called The Battle Isles that is limited to GW PvP. The reward for winning a PvP tournament includes experience points and faction points which can be exchanged for in-game awards. PvP combat is completely optional and players may use their own character or one that is created especially for PvP. There are 8 different characters classes or Guild Wars Professions: Elementalist, Mesmer, Monk, Necromancer, Ranger, Warrior, Assassin, and Ritualist. Each GW character consists of a primary and secondary profession which determines what skills and attributes the character will have. Players are able to change their character secondary profession by completing certain tasks. Players must select GW Builds for their character which is a combination of skills, attributes, and sometimes weapons. Guild Wars builds usually consist of 8 skills such as attack skills and spells. An effective combination of skills has to be selected or even the level of the characters and the equipment they carry will be void if the skills are not useful for the task the player is attempting. Although not a requirement, joining a GW guild is highly encouraged being that so much of the game is focusing around playing within a guild. By joining a guild players are able to communicate more readily and exchange Guild Wars strategies and tips. The guild leaders are usually responsible for recruiting new members and up to ten guilds may join together to form a GW alliance. Members of the alliance can visit guild halls of other guilds within their alliance and communicate with each other through a chat channel.
